Transaction 25ba21934147286c3f3567b87a56dbc348f1b74f7ea344ff7e221caf7d286c5a

1 Input
2 Outputs
  • 25ba21934147286c3f3567b87a56dbc348f1b74f7ea344ff7e221caf7d286c5a:0
  • value  8421838
    address  14PvwoJCfFjqzCwrHEP3ezPhkb2EqBK3KA
  • 25ba21934147286c3f3567b87a56dbc348f1b74f7ea344ff7e221caf7d286c5a:1
  • value  100000000
    address  1AqHTqoR4zVQpqAB5MCq4HUqtSkpfV77EH